Some sheet metal whose length exceeds the bending tooling capacity can be manu-factured based on sectional forming where there are some problems such as line difficulties, poor forming,and stress concentration,however.In this paper,the process of segmental bending forming production was discussed.The finite element software was used to simulate and analyze the appearance quality and thickness variation of parts in the process of forming and after forming;The typical parts were verified by production and their appearance quali-ty and drawing performance were considered.The results indicate that the segmental ben-ding forming can meet the production requirements of specific parts and could be used as an alternative scheme in the part production with low appearance quality and low working load requirements.%某些长度超出弯曲工装工艺能力的板料,可以采用分段成形的工艺方法进行生产,但这种方法存在对线困难、成形不良和应力集中等问题.对分段成形生产的工艺过程进行了探讨,利用有限元软件模拟分析零件成形过程及成形后的外观质量和厚度的变化,对典型零件进行了生产验证,观察其外观质量并考量拉延性能.结果表明,分段成形能够符合特定零件的生产需要,在外观质量要求不高、工作载荷不大的零件生产中能够作为替代方案.
